  • Keeping Kids Healthier at School

    Funded Dec 31, 2011

    Thank you so much for your donation! My students are very appreciative of you for the disinfectant wipes, sani-hand wipes (to sanitizer), the tissue and paper towels as well as the soap. We learned about germs and ways to not spread them.

    Children were able to disinfect their desks and chairs on a regular basis. Although, a few still got sick, I am sure it was not due to our classroom environment!

    Students learned that germs are spread by not covering their mouths when coughing or sneezing. They made sure to sanitize every time they sneezed or coughed in their hands. They also reminded their classmates if any of them forgot to do that.

    Because of your donation, my students were able to learn in a clean and sweet smelling environment. Thanks a million. ”

  • Pocket Dictionaries

    Funded Dec 30, 2009

    I would like to thank you from the bottom of my heart for your donation.

    In this age of technology, basic skills like dictionary skills have fallen to the waste side. It is still important for children to learn how to use this reference tool. Especially, children that are english language learners. They need to be able to acquire word and learn their meanings.

    The sentences my students are now producing have improved 100%. They are also using the words in their daily vocabulary! Each child was able to take a dictionary home to work on homework assignments and share with their families. There were 5 left over for the classroom and students use them in small group work in reading and during writing workshop.

    Other teachers have been inspired to write proposals on the website because of your immediate response to our need. Thank you for giving, thank you for your generosity. ”

I having been working with children for the past 26 years as a teacher, literacy coach and teacher mentor. Teaching is the best job in the world! I have an opportunity every single day to touch the future and inspire! Every child has what it takes to be amazing and my goal, as an educator, is simply to help them reach theirs! Unfortunately, it takes resources to supplement our work as educators and there is not enough funding in our school budgets to really give our children what they deserve. With the help of donors, we are somewhat able to level the playing field. Thanking you all in advance for your consideration! Ms. Winfrey
